Virat Kohli recently added a touch of humor to a discussion about his Test cricket retirement at Yuvraj Singh's YouWeCan cancer fundraiser in London. Residing in London, Kohli made a stylish appearance at the event, shortly after being seen at Wimbledon dressed in a sleek brown suit. Amid a gathering that included the Indian cricket team, event host Gaurav Kapur acknowledged Kohli's absence from the squad, following his retirement announcement before the England tour. “We miss you on the field man,” Kapur remarked, prompting a lighthearted response from Kohli. Standing alongside cricket legends Ravi Shastri, Chris Gayle, Kevin Pietersen, and Yuvraj Singh, Kohli quipped, “I just coloured my beard two days ago. You know it's time when you are colouring your beard every four days. It's time to relax." During the fundraiser, Kohli also opened up about his significant partnership with former head coach Ravi Shastri, crediting him for India's remarkable achievements in Test cricket under his captaincy. “Honestly, if I wasn't working with him, what happened in Test cricket wouldn't have been possible," Kohli stated, emphasizing the clarity and support he received from Shastri. Recalling Shastri's unwavering defense in press conferences, Kohli expressed gratitude, acknowledging the coach’s crucial role in his cricketing journey. In return, Shastri praised Kohli as the most influential cricketer of the past 15 years. He admired Kohli’s ambition to elevate India's Test cricket, a vision that led to significant advancements for the team. Shastri highlighted the economic impact of India’s Test success, attributing increased revenues and global recognition to Kohli's leadership. "If India is playing a level of Test match cricket today, especially the younger generation that played under him, they should thank him," Shastri noted, underscoring Kohli’s transformative influence in international cricket.
